Jesse Eisenberg Autistic Spectrum Disorder

Jessie Eisenberg does not have an Autistic Spectrum Disorder. Instead, he had an Anxiety Disorder.

Eisenberg has been open about his struggle to fit in at school due to an anxiety disorder, not Autism.

Though both conditions have similar symptoms, there is a difference between an anxiety disorder and an autistic spectrum disorder. 

People with both conditions feel difficulties in social situations and routine changes. Autism is related to neurodevelopmental, while anxiety is a mental health condition.

Jesse Eisenberg had an anxiety disorder as a kid. (Source: Page Six)

Jessie Eisenberg was perpetually anxious and struggled through elementary school, even missing a year.

Luckily, his parents enrolled him in an acting school at an early age, which helped a lot in his personal development.

At seven, he portrayed Oliver Twist in a children’s theater production of the musical Oliver!

By 12, Eisenberg was an understudy in the 1996 Broadway revival of Tennessee Williams’ Summer and Smoke.

He even landed a role in a tv series (which was soon canceled) in high school. He made his movie debut at 18, in 2002, with Roger Dodger.

Jesse Eisenberg Wife And Kids

Jesse Eisenberg is married to his longtime girlfriend, Anna Strout.

Anna is credited as an additional crew in Digital_Man/Digital_World (assistant business manager) and Fire and Ice: The Winter War of Finland and Russia (talent coordinator).

The couple met in the early 2000s on the set of The Emperor’s Club. Anna was an assistant to the producer Lisa Bruce.

They dated for a decade, from 2002 to 2012, before breaking off. Anna worked behind the scenes in movies.

Jesse then started dating the Australian actress Mia Wasikowska, his co-star in The Double. The two dated from 2013 to 2015.

After his relationship with Wasikowska ended, Eisenberg resumed his romance with his former girlfriend, Anna Strout.

The couple married in 2017 and welcomed their son, Banner, in April of the same year.

Not much is known about Banner and Anna since Jessie does not use social media and prefers his personal life out of the limelight.

Jesse Eisenberg Family Background

Jesse Eisenberg was born to Barry and Amy Eisenberg in Queens, New York City, on October 5, 1983.

His mother, Amy (née Fishman), worked as a choreographer for a Catholic high school and as a clown at children’s parties. She teaches cross-cultural sensitivity in hospitals.

His father, Barry, initially drove a taxicab and later worked at a hospital. He later became a sociology professor at a college.

Jesse has two sisters: Hallie Eisenberg and Kerry Lea. Hallie is a former child actress, once famous as the “Pepsi girl” in commercials.

Kerry is an independent artist based in New York. She was also an actor and ran an animal rights-based children’s theater troupe.
